
The Centre for Supervision Training and Development (CSTD) has been running supervision training since 1979.
CSTD Bath Supervision Training has been officially recognised by the HIP College of UKCP as a 'Recognised Supervisor Training' (RST) since 2016 and meets all requirements for this recognition.
We will be continuing courses both online and face-to-face in 2022
Each year we will offer our Programme with all the Modules both face-to-face and online. This is in order to easily accommodate our many students from overseas. Feel free to 'mix and match' your choices between the different modes of presentation.
CSTD Bath has a Diploma and Certificate programme; provides in-house bespoke training and continuing professional development in supervision for all those in the helping professions including counsellors, psychotherapists, psychologists, social workers, nurses, doctors, occupational therapists, teachers and many more.
The wide range of professions we work with reflects our philosophy which is to be as inclusive as possible in all senses. It is based on 35 years of supervising, training supervisors and writing and researching about supervision internationally. Our models and curricula are suitable for many professions, theoretical approaches, work situations and length of experience. We aim to provide the requirements for professional accreditation as supervisors including those of BACP, UKCP and BPS.
